Output 5d026959bb82ae22221d7b391c80f1edc0d45037266b8517be46acb091a64596:0

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9af1e214cb089ca68eb0efb1e71088410a0e65c6 OP_EQUAL
address
3FpHkRKa6x74WEfVuL4sqt8UXZBVpiYBqR
transaction
5d026959bb82ae22221d7b391c80f1edc0d45037266b8517be46acb091a64596
confirmations
353453
spent
true